Fort Buchanan sits within the Guaynabo corridor of the San Juan metropolitan area, and while the installation maintains managed infrastructure designed for durability, the surrounding residential and commercial properties face the same tropical weather threats that define life across Puerto Rico. When a storm surge, extended rainfall, or a major hurricane event forces floodwater into structures near the base, property owners are left managing both visible structural damage and a claim process that demands precise documentation from the very first day. At Water Restore Plus, we treat the insurance adjuster relationship as a core part of every reconstruction engagement, not an afterthought.
Our team arrives on-site with the tools and protocols to build a claim file that holds up under adjuster review. We photograph and measure affected areas systematically, cross-referencing moisture readings with visible damage markers to create a scope document that reflects actual conditions rather than surface appearances. Line-item estimates are prepared in formats that insurance carriers recognize, accounting for Puerto Rico labor and materials costs that often differ from mainland benchmarks. This distinction matters significantly in the San Juan metro, where post-storm demand, island supply chains, and specialty subcontractors affect real project costs. Presenting accurate local cost data from the outset keeps claims moving and reduces the back-and-forth that delays reconstruction.
Supplemental claims are a necessary and legitimate part of many reconstruction projects near Fort Buchanan, particularly when initial adjuster estimates fail to account for hidden moisture intrusion behind walls, damaged structural framing beneath finishes, or contamination found during demolition. We document these conditions as they are discovered, capturing the supporting evidence an adjuster needs to process a supplement without dispute. Our written reports include cause-of-loss analysis, material specifications, and repair methodology descriptions that give carriers the information required to approve additional line items. Property owners should not absorb costs that belong in the claim, and thorough supplemental documentation is how that outcome is protected.
Settlement documentation is the final piece of a well-managed reconstruction claim. Before any project closes, Water Restore Plus prepares a completion package that includes signed certificates of satisfactory repair, final photographs, and itemized records of all work performed. This file serves as the legal and financial record of what was done and what the claim covered, protecting the property owner if questions arise months or years later.
